    Going rate of pay

    What is the going rate of pay in your area for certified Opticians?
    I 'm going to ask for a raise the 1st of the year and want to make sure of my facts before I ask. I'm in the KC area and I have an idea of what some folks make here, but of course its just so different for every office.

    I suggest checking Eyecare Business's October 2008 edition. They have a salary survey article by Erinn Morgan, entitled Compensation Nation.

    The average salary for a licensed Optician is $40,000.

    Go to www.bls.gov from there on the left side there is a pay and benefits. Select wages by area and occupation. Select State wage data, select your state, select 29-0000 healthcare practioner and technical occupations, we are 29-2081. Hope this helps.
